Bengaluru, 29th May 2026: The Department of Aerospace Engineering at JAIN (Deemed-to-be University) hosted the National Conference on Emerging Trends in Engineering & Technology (NCETET 2026) on 29 May 2026, bringing together 179 participants from academic institutions, research organisations and industry in a hybrid format.
Held at the Faculty of Engineering and Technology (JU-FET), the conference provided a platform for researchers, faculty members, students and professionals to present and discuss their work in emerging areas of engineering. A total of 62 research papers were presented across technical sessions covering Aerospace Engineering, Artificial Intelligence and Machine Learning, Digital Twin technologies, and Advanced Materials.
The day focused on research exchange and technical discussions rather than keynote-driven proceedings. Presenters shared studies on aircraft structures, aerodynamics, propulsion systems, smart manufacturing, predictive maintenance, data-driven engineering approaches and sustainable material solutions. Each session provided opportunities for participants to receive feedback, discuss methodologies and explore future directions for their work.
The conference was chaired by Dr. Prakash Damodar Mangalgiri, Professor of Eminence, and Dr. Sudhir Sastry Y B, Professor and Head of the Department of Aerospace Engineering. Distinguished invitees Dr. Kishore Brahma and Ashok Aseri interacted with participants and contributed to discussions on current developments and challenges in engineering and technology.
One of the key outcomes of NCETET 2026 was the interaction between students, researchers and industry professionals. The hybrid format enabled wider participation, allowing delegates from different parts of the country to engage in technical sessions and networking activities.
Supported by the Aeronautical Society of India and the Institution of Mechanical Engineers, the conference highlighted the growing interest in interdisciplinary research and the application of emerging technologies to real-world engineering challenges.
